About
Harbor Community Health Centers is a nonprofit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C) in San Pedro, California, serving about 6,900+ patients. It operates as a primary care practice with three offices (all in San Pedro), offering comprehensive services across multiple disciplines including primary care, pediatrics, OB/GYN, behavioral health, dental, podiatry, immunizations, diabetes management, nutrition, women’s health, and preventive care (e.g., mammograms, HIV prevention). Exer Urgent Care is a privately held urgent/emergency care provider with 20 clinics across Southern California, founded in 2012 and headquartered in El Segundo. They offer on-site X-ray and labs, treatment for everyday emergencies (staying 7 days a week, 8am–8pm), and services including medical weight loss, with insurance and self-pay options. The network emphasizes rapid, lower-cost ER-style care and operates clinics in the Los Angeles area and nearby communities.
